In regards to what makes a good book cover, the key is designing a cover which completely encapsulates the overall genre, theme and mood of the book itself. A book's cover design is the window into its story; it allows bookworms to have a quick look at the basic ambience of the novel itself. Through the book cover, readers can get a concept of what to anticipate from the novel, without offering far too much away. This is exactly why the book cover design ought to align with the genre of the book as much as possible. For instance, if the novel is a fun, light-hearted summer romance, the book cover must contain bright, vibrant illustrations which mirrors this. On the other hand, some of the most effective ideas for book covers of the horror or thriller category would be utilizing darker colour tones and gothic images.

There are a lot of things to consider when designing a book cover, ranging from the colour palette to the composition. In addition, there are various ways to design a book cover; some developers use hand drawn images and artwork to create the main image of the book cover, whereas others use graphic design software on computers. Alternatively, a considerable amount of book covers actually incorporate digital photography instead of illustrations, like by having a photograph of a cabin in the woods for a thriller novel for instance. Even the kind of font utilized on the cover needs to be carefully considered. For example, a typewriter, handwritten or calligraphic font will likely be best for a historical book which is set in a particular age.

In regards to how to design a book cover, the initial thing to note is that it is a joint effort. Lots of people believe that it is the work of one designer, however this is not the situation. In truth, it takes an entire group of designers, illustrators and editors, together with the experience of the larger marketing, sales and production teams, to make a book cover. Naturally, the writer is consulted towards the end of the process when a drafted cover has been developed. Whilst the author's point of view is widely important, ultimately the art department will make the final verdict on the front cover design.
